Let the coin be tossed n times and let X-denote the number of heads in n tosses of the coin. Then,
`therefore P(X=r)= .^(n)C_(r )((1)/(2))^(r )((1)/(2))^(n-r) = .^(n)C_(r )((1)/(2))^(n), r=0,1,2,..,n`
It is given that
`P(X ge 2) ge 0.96`
`implies underset(r=2)overset(n)(sum)P(X=r) ge 0.96`
`implies underset(r=2)overset(n)(sum) .^(n)C_(r )((1)/(2))^(n) ge 0.96`
`implies (1)/(2^(n))( underset(r=2)overset(n)(sum) .^(n)C_(r )) ge 0.96`
`implies (1)/(2^(n)) (2^(n) - .^(n)C_(0) - .^(n)C_(1)) ge 0.96`
`implies 1-(n+1)/(2^(n)) ge 0.96`
`implies (n+1) le (0.04) 2^(n)`
`implies n=8, 9, 10,`..
